If Waffles Were Like Boys

978-0-06177-998-5.
COPY ISBN
PreS-Gr 2—A short, lightly humorous bedtime story. The text follows an unnamed youngster throughout his day, comparing boys' personalities to, well, waffles, among other things. "If waffles were like boys, breakfast would be a battlefield!"; "If hot dogs were like boys, picnics would be rodeos!"; "If toothbrushes were like boys, bathrooms would be jungles….Good night, boys." The cartoon illustrations carry the story; they are colorful and whimsical. Moms of rambunctious boys will probably relate to the protagonist's energy level. However, this book still qualifies as a secondary purchase.—Roxanne Burg, Orange County Public Library, CA
In this fun-filled book, a boy uses his imagination to transform everyday routines into action-packed adventures: "If shopping carts were like boys...grocery stores would be RACETRACKS!" The illustrations are bursting with activity and inventive detail, depicting ordinary objects such as food, socks, and pillows as characters in some kind of lively recreation, race, or battle.
